A subcutaneous injection is essentially an injection that's given under your skin. It differs from an intramuscular injection, which delivers medication directly into the muscle.A Comprehensive Guide to Peptide Injections Instead, the subcutaneous route targets the adipose tissue, the fatty layer of tissues just under the skin. This specific layer offers a rich blood supply, facilitating the gradual release and absorption of the peptide.
The process of administering a subcutaneous peptide injection typically involves using a fine needle to deposit the peptide solution into the subcutaneous fat. This technique is favored as subcutaneous injections support gradual absorption into fatty tissue. Several types of peptides can be administered this way. For example, Weight loss peptides are short chains of amino acids that mimic hormones involved in appetite and metabolism. Similarly, Growth hormone releasing peptides (GHRPs) stimulate the release of growth hormone, which can aid in metabolism, fat loss, and muscle maintenance.Characterization and impact of peptide physicochemical ... Tesamorelin, used to reduce excess fat in patients with HIV infection, is another example administered via the subcutaneous route.
